Tiagra is the name of a road bike group from the Japanese manufacturer Shimano . It is considered a beginner group and ranks in the price and weight category below the Shimano 105 group and above the Sora group.

history

The Shimano Tiagra group was introduced around the year 2000 and replaced the previously existing RX100 group. Tiagra has been offered as a ten-fold group since 2012. In 2005, the Octalink mount was introduced for the group's crank and bottom bracket. A year later, the Hollowtech II technology for the connection between crank and bottom bracket was defined as the standard for the 4500 series. STIs with integrated gear displays have also been available for the group since then. In 2012, Shimano changed the shifting technology with the 4600 series so that regular racing bike cassettes with 32 teeth on the largest sprocket are offered for the group. The group was henceforth available in the ten-fold version. The 4700 series was presented in 2016. The components cassettes and crank as well as the cable routing and the rear derailleur have been expanded or improved. The crank was converted to the new four-arm design and supplied in the variant with double and triple chainrings. Cranks are available in four lengths from 165 to 175 mm.

While all other Shimano groups are now available in the eleven-fold version, the Tiagra group has not been extended to this standard (as of 2018).

According to the tour, the difference in weight to the high-quality Ultegra group amounts to around 350 grams more weight in the 9-fold variants .
